Longkamp is located on the Moselle heights and stretches across a long plateau in the Hunsrück.
Nature
Longkamp has an extensive local network of hiking trails. Cycling and mountain biking are other leisure options, and three circular hikes start in the town centre.
The Mühlenweg trail leads through Longkamp’s Mühlental valley along the Trabener Bach and passes seven historic mills. The 11.5 kilometre route combines beech forests, open fields and views towards the Eifel. The Mühlenweg also includes a viewpoint overlooking the Kautenbach valley and shady rest areas at Kaisergarten.
The Hubertusweg trail runs across fields, meadows and pastures with short sections through woodland. The Tiefenbach Tour follows the Tiefenbach valley, where the stream cuts through rock between Longkamp and Bernkastel-Kues. Culture and History
Longkamp was first mentioned in documents in 1030. The town’s Roman settlement tradition is associated with excavated finds from 1888 and 1889 in the Furtflörchen district. Fifteen burial mounds in the Bistum district are cited as evidence of Roman settlement.
The local history museum is housed in a former mill room and milling area and preserves local traditions, history and customs. A 16.5 centimetre-high statue found around 1912 is on display at the Rheinisches Landesmuseum. The Mali House presents information about Africa, particularly Mali.
The wayside chapel at the southern entrance to the town dates from 1775 or 1776 and contains three sandstone reliefs depicting the Passion. The votive chapel outside Longkamp was built in 1892/93 in honour of Our Lady of Sorrows. It was often the destination of a May candlelight procession.
